Waste incinerators have become a popular method for disposing of garbage in recent years, but the cost associated with these facilities goes far beyond their initial construction While incineration can be an effective way to reduce the volume of waste that ends up in landfills, it comes with a hefty price tag that can have significant economic implications for the communities that host these facilities.
The cost of building a waste incinerator can vary widely depending on a number of factors, including the size and capacity of the facility, the technology used, and the location In general, however, constructing a waste incinerator is a major infrastructure project that requires a substantial amount of capital investment According to the Environmental Protection Agency (EPA), the cost of building a waste incineration facility can range from $100 million to over $1 billion, with larger facilities typically costing more to construct.
In addition to the initial construction costs, waste incinerators also incur significant ongoing operational expenses These facilities require a steady supply of fuel to keep them running, and the cost of this fuel can add up quickly In many cases, waste-to-energy facilities burn municipal solid waste (MSW) as fuel, but this can be expensive and may not always be readily available Some waste incinerators also require specialized equipment and maintenance to keep them operating efficiently, adding to the overall cost of operating these facilities.
The economic impact of waste incinerators extends beyond the direct costs of construction and operation These facilities can also have a number of indirect costs that can impact the communities that host them One of the biggest concerns is the potential impact on property values near waste incinerators Studies have shown that living near a waste incinerator can have a negative impact on property values, as the facilities can generate noise, odors, and other environmental concerns that can make an area less desirable to live in.

Burning waste releases a number of harmful pollutants into the air, including dioxins, mercury, and other toxic substances that can have serious health effects These pollutants can contribute to a range of health problems, including respiratory illnesses, heart disease, and cancer, all of which can lead to increased healthcare costs for residents living near waste incinerators.
Another economic consideration for waste incinerators is the potential impact on recycling and waste reduction efforts Some critics argue that waste incinerators can actually discourage recycling and other diversion programs, as they provide a convenient way to dispose of waste without having to sort or separate recyclable materials This can be a significant concern for communities that are trying to increase their recycling rates and reduce the amount of waste that ends up in landfills.
Despite the high costs associated with waste incinerators, some proponents argue that these facilities can actually provide economic benefits to communities in the form of jobs and tax revenue Waste-to-energy facilities require a skilled workforce to operate and maintain them, which can create employment opportunities for local residents Additionally, waste incinerators can generate electricity and other forms of energy that can be sold to the grid, providing a source of revenue for the facility and potentially reducing energy costs for the community.
Overall, the true cost of waste incinerators goes far beyond the initial construction and operational expenses These facilities can have a range of economic impacts on the communities that host them, from property value declines to increased healthcare costs and potential impacts on recycling efforts While waste incinerators can provide some economic benefits in the form of jobs and tax revenue, it is important for communities to carefully consider the full economic implications of these facilities before deciding to build or expand them.
